Sandra Thom-Jones When I received my autism diagnosis it was a huge relief. I joined online groups and I read everything I could find on autism in adults (and autism in…moreWhen I received my autism diagnosis it was a huge relief. I joined online groups and I read everything I could find on autism in adults (and autism in women). I read lots of memoirs, which were really insightful and engaging but left me with lots of ‘why’ and ‘how’ questions. As an autism researcher working in a university, I read lots of academic journal articles, which provided detailed scientific information but didn’t connect to my lived experience. I wanted a book that described different aspects of what it is like to be autistic, explaining the characteristics referred to in the literature but in a way that was more human and made sense to me as an autistic person. Then my son’s psychologist said to me “you should write one”…. It took me a couple of years, but I eventually wrote the book I wanted to read when I was diagnosed, and I really hope it fills that gap for other autistic people.(less)
